The Institute of Civil Engineers is 200 years old soon, and the Manchester branch plan to celebrate this by creating a 1:10 (length) scale model in lego of the Liverpool to Manchester railway. This would be a Guinness World record.

If anyone (especially of an engineering or construction background) in the NW would like to be involved, PM me and I'll put you in touch with one of my colleagues.
 
Where? 1:10? Wouldn't that be three and a half miles long?!

Yep.

Design/Logistics is still to be decided. Initial call for volunteers to help work out how to do this. Very much at the concept stage. First meeting Monday 18th, Charlotte Street, Manchester.

EDIT: if you could get it in Manchester Central (with a extra curves to keep it doubling back on itself) that would be fitting. It's not the original terminus, but it was for a while and it is a bloody great big ex-railway shed. I'll suggest that to them. Both ICE and Manchester Central.
 
I imagine it would require most of the world's supply of Lego too! A 1:10 railway station is still going to be the size of a house!

My Saturn V is complete. A huge thing, it stands exactly as high as a JR149 on its Target R4 stand.
 
The track length will be 1:10. Some liberties may be taken with the rest I suspect. The current lego / model train track record is about 4 km (this would be over 5 km) - there is no need to make it exact for the record. I suspect some key landmarks (bridges, rivers etc) will be sprinkled in as appropriate.
